GSConnect / gnome-shell-extension-gsconnect

KDE Connect implementation for GNOME
GNU General Public License v2.0
3.18k stars 255 forks source link

Failed to install DBus Service #1473

Open bornolbers opened 2 years ago

bornolbers commented 2 years ago

The settings of extension gsconnect@andyholmes.github.io had an error:

Error: GSConnect: Failed to install DBus Service

Stack trace:

installService@/home/pluto/.local/share/gnome-shell/extensions/gsconnect@andyholmes.github.io/shell/utils.js:177:19
init@/home/pluto/.local/share/gnome-shell/extensions/gsconnect@andyholmes.github.io/prefs.js:12:11
_init@resource:///org/gnome/Shell/Extensions/js/extensionPrefsDialog.js:24:25
ExtensionPrefsDialog@resource:///org/gnome/Shell/Extensions/js/extensionPrefsDialog.js:10:4
OpenExtensionPrefsAsync/<@resource:///org/gnome/Shell/Extensions/js/extensionsService.js:129:33
asyncCallback@resource:///org/gnome/gjs/modules/core/overrides/Gio.js:115:22
run@resource:///org/gnome/Shell/Extensions/js/dbusService.js:186:20
main@resource:///org/gnome/Shell/Extensions/js/main.js:22:13
run@resource:///org/gnome/gjs/modules/script/package.js:206:19
start@resource:///org/gnome/gjs/modules/script/package.js:190:8
@/usr/share/gnome-shell/org.gnome.Shell.Extensions:1:17
luna-xenia commented 1 year ago

I also have this issue, I'm not sure what details you need but I'll give what might be relevant:

OS: Xenia Linux (Gentoo Linux) GNOME version: 44.1 (latest stable on Gentoo) Installing through Extension Manager flatpak.

Other extensions work fine, I have extensions like Blur My Shell and OpenWeather installed just fine.

Here is the error:

Error: GSConnect: Failed to install DBus Service

Stack trace:
  installService@/home/luna/.local/share/gnome-shell/extensions/gsconnect@andyholmes.github.io/shell/utils.js:182:19
  init@/home/luna/.local/share/gnome-shell/extensions/gsconnect@andyholmes.github.io/prefs.js:14:11
  _init@resource:///org/gnome/Shell/Extensions/js/extensionPrefsDialog.js:24:25
  ExtensionPrefsDialog@resource:///org/gnome/Shell/Extensions/js/extensionPrefsDialog.js:10:4
  OpenExtensionPrefsAsync@resource:///org/gnome/Shell/Extensions/js/extensionsService.js:124:33
  async*LaunchExtensionPrefsAsync@resource:///org/gnome/Shell/Extensions/js/extensionsService.js:110:14
  _handleMethodCall@resource:///org/gnome/gjs/modules/core/overrides/Gio.js:373:35
  _wrapJSObject/<@resource:///org/gnome/gjs/modules/core/overrides/Gio.js:408:34
  run@resource:///org/gnome/Shell/Extensions/js/dbusService.js:186:20
  main@resource:///org/gnome/Shell/Extensions/js/main.js:22:13
  run@resource:///org/gnome/gjs/modules/script/package.js:206:19
  start@resource:///org/gnome/gjs/modules/script/package.js:190:8
  @/usr/share/gnome-shell/org.gnome.Shell.Extensions:1:17

Please let me know if I can help with more information etc

EDIT: seems like this might be a Gentoo issue, this works on systemd but not openrc.